If you are taking your car to the repair shop for service, be sure you know how they charge for the work being done. Many shops charge a flat rate for most jobs, but others charge based on the amount of time it takes to complete a repair. While both methods can be quite legitimate, it is useful to know which approach your shop is using to help you anticipate final costs.

If you need to get your car fixed after an accident, you should contact your insurance to get a list of approved mechanics. Going to an approved mechanic means your insurance will cover some of your expenses. Besides, you are more likely to find more information a good certified mechanic if you go to a professional chosen by your insurance company.

Choose a mechanic that is happy to explain the problem to you. Some mechanics feel that they know so much that the customer could never understand, but even if you do not fully understand the problem or what is being done, they should be happy to try their best to inform you about it. It is a huge sign that they are a good mechanic all-around.

Always ask lots of questions when you take your car to get repaired. Don't let the mechanic intimidate you. Ask why something needs to be fixed or how it will be done. If the mechanic tries to brush you off, doesn't look at you, More or refuses to answer your questions, consider taking your car to someone else.

If you know the specific model that you want, call the dealership to see if they have it on the lot. Once you walk through a dealership's doors, they will try to sell you anything and everything, even if it isn't what you are really interested in. If the dealer does not have a car that meets your needs, your trip will be a waste. Calling in advance can save you a lot of time and hassle.
